Understanding TTS: A Text-to-Speech Process

Text-to-speech (TTS) systems has grown increasingly sophisticated, but what does it really work? At its core, TTS transforms written language into audible copyright. The process usually involves a few crucial stages. Initially, the source text undergoes text analysis – this includes recognizing the copyright, punctuation, and sentence format. Next, a text parser breaks down the content into its component parts, determining pronunciation based on linguistic principles and vocabularies. Then comes the speech generation, where the program uses either a concatenative technique, which stitches together pre-recorded sounds, or a parametric process, which produces speech synthetically based on mathematical equations. Finally, the resulting signal is output as text to speech audible speech. Modern TTS platforms often integrate these approaches for the level of naturalness and quality.
